私钥是比特币钱包的核心组成部分,它决定了用户对其比特币的控制权。每个比特币地址都有一个匹配的私钥,只有掌握该私钥,用户才能进行比特币的转移和交易。这一机制确保了比特币的安全性和去中心化特征。在比特币网络中,交易是由私钥签名的,签名证明了发送者对比特币的所有权,同时确保了交易的不可篡改性。理论上,只有拥有对应私钥的人才能解锁钱包并使用存储的比特币。
私钥的保密性至关重要。一旦私钥被他人获取,这意味着对私钥对应的比特币地址的完全控制。因此,用户需要采取有效措施保护其私钥,比如使用硬件钱包、加密存储等方式。
####比特币私钥的生成涉及多种加密技术。首先,生成私钥需要一个强随机数生成器(CSPRNG)。CSPRNG能够生成难以预测的随机数,这是私钥生成过程的基础。随后,这些随机数会经过加密哈希函数,通常是SHA-256,生成私钥。SHA-256能将输入的信息压缩成一定长度的输出,从而提高了私钥的安全性。
在此过程中,私钥的长度通常为256位,这使得可能的私钥组合数量达到2的256次方,理论上几乎无法通过暴力破解来获取。不过,生成私钥时仍然需要确保随机数的质量,使用较弱的随机数生成器可能会导致私钥的可预测性,从而影响安全性。
####目前市场上有许多工具可以用来生成比特币私钥,主要分为软件钱包、硬件钱包和在线工具。软件钱包如Electrum和Exodus提供了方便的界面来生成私钥,用户只需下载并安装即可。硬件钱包如Ledger和Trezor则提供高安全性的硬件设备,私钥在设备内部生成并存储,大大降低了被攻击的风险。
此外,还有一些在线工具可用于生成比特币私钥,虽然它们操作方便,但由于存在安全隐患,不建议在没有保证的环境下使用。用户在选择任何工具时,都应仔细考量其安全性和可靠性,避免私钥泄露。
####在管理比特币私钥时,备份与恢复是其重要组成部分。比特币的去中心化特性意味着用户需要对自己的资金负责,务必保证私钥的安全存储与备份。通常,私钥的备份可以通过几种方式来实现,包括书面记录、使用安全的密码管理器或硬件钱包。
在恢复方面,用户需要保留好助记词或恢复短语,这些是生成私钥的关键组成部分。若用户丢失了访问钱包的设备或忘记密码,只需输入恢复短语,便可重新访问个人的比特币地址。因此,备份的保密性和安全性同样不容小觑,应采取适当措施来防止信息泄露。
####私钥的安全管理涉及多项最佳实践。首先,避免将私钥存储在联网的设备上,特别是在云端存储。最好使用离线方法生成并管理私钥,如使用纸钱包或硬件钱包。同时,确保定期更新密码和密钥,定期检查钱包的安全状况。
其次,启用双重身份验证(2FA)是另一个提高安全性的方式。即使攻击者获取了私钥,未设置双重身份验证的情况下,他们仍然无法进行转移交易。此外,用户应在安全环境下进行交易,避免在公共Wi-Fi网络上访问比特币钱包。
重要的是,教育自己并保持对网络安全的警惕性,了解最新的安全威胁和防范措施十分必要。随时关注安全动态,可以更好地保护自己的私钥及比特币。
####随着区块链技术的发展,私钥生成和管理的工具也随之演变。未来,随着量子计算的发展,传统的加密算法可能会面临挑战,导致现有私钥的安全性受到威胁。因此,科研人员正在研究量子抗性加密算法,这将为私钥管理提供新的解决方案。
另一方面,增强现实(AR)和虚拟现实(VR)技术的应用,有可能改变用户与比特币钱包的交互方式,使得私钥管理变得更加直观和安全。此外,基于区块链的身份验证技术将可能进一步增强私钥的安全性,确保用户身份的唯一性和私钥的安全存储。
在未来,智能合约和去中心化金融(DeFi)平台普及可能需要更复杂的私钥管理机制。用户可能需要以更灵活的方式来控制他们的私钥,确保安全性和实用性的平衡。
### 结论 比特币钱包的私钥生成是保障比特币安全的基础。理解私钥生成的技术与工具,以及适当的管理策略,对于每一位比特币用户来说皆不可或缺。通过不断学习和适应新兴技术,用户能有效管理和保护自己的数字资产。
leave a reply